Looking for great places to dine with the children this summer? From country pubs with playgrounds to film-themed eateries, here are our top picks — all within easy reach of Bishop’s Stortford:
The Brewery Tap (Furneux Pelham, near Bishop’s Stortford)
Location: Barleycroft End, Furneux Pelham, SG9 — a short drive from Stortford
Why visit: A family-friendly village pub with an outdoor playground and locally sourced menu — perfect for little ones to burn off energy.
The Catherine Wheel (Albury, just outside Bishop’s Stortford)
Location: Pelham Road, Albury, SG11 2LW
Why visit: A welcoming pub with a large beer garden, kids’ menu, and outdoor play area for family visits.
The Nag’s Head (Bishop’s Stortford)
Location: 216 Dunmow Road, CM23 5HP
Why visit: An Art Deco Chicken & Grill pub with a children’s play area, colouring activities, and a spacious beer garden.
The Moorhen (Harlow – just across the border)
Location: Off the A414, Harlow, Essex
Why visit: A pub/grill offering family-friendly meals, river views, and a children’s area.
The Harvest Moon (Bishop’s Stortford)
Location: Friedberg Avenue, CM23 4RF
Why visit: A converted farmhouse pub with a large garden and outdoor play area — renowned locally for its family-friendly atmosphere.
The Three Willows (Birchanger, near Stortford)
Location: 327 Birchanger Lane, CM23 5QR
Why visit: A charming country pub with a garden, pet-friendly, excellent pub mains, fresh seafood, and homemade desserts.
